Top Definition
a sexual act invented in La Porte TX in the summer of 2005 mostly drug induced act this act will forever unspoken of and only known as the "geegle foot"
Ben: what happened last night trav?
Travis: i woke up in beaus arms with a odd oder in the room and a greasy stomach

Ben: damn that nigga geegle footed you
by t-rizzy April 28, 2011

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.